Start your Fiji adventure at the Suva Municipal Market known to be the largest local fresh produce market in Fiji. The market sells a wide variety of local fruits, vegetables, fish, and handmade artifacts from local artisans. Make sure to try the local favorite drink, Kava, which is a Fijian ceremonial drink made from the roots of the Kava plant.
Visit the Nabua Fiji Police Special Response Unit Training Base where the Fijian police train for any national security challenges they may face. For adventure-seekers, head to Zip Fiji, which offers eco-adventure using zipline and treetop canopy tours of the lush forests and streams of Pacific Harbour.
Sigatoka Sand Dunes National Park is Fiji's first national park. It is an archaeological site containing pottery shards, stone tools and human remains dating back to 3500 years B.C. After this historical sight-seeing, ride the Zipline at the Kula Wild Adventure Park and experience the South Pacific Jungle.
Explore the tropical gardens at the Garden of the Sleeping Giant, a landscaped garden housing a variety of orchids, lilies, and other plants. Complete your perfect Fiji experience by relaxing at the natural hot springs at Sabeto.
If you have more time, consider visiting Tavuni Hill Fort, the largest remaining fort in Fiji or the Cololav Island Beach Club, located in the secluded Mamanuca Islands.
